Brentford don't have any money and seem to have to sell their best players every transfer window but their squad has obviously been assembled with a vision of how they will fit in and play together.

Since we came down we've been the poster child for a terrible transfer policy. 1st season splurge on whoever had done well in the championship over the last year or so. No thought whatsoever as to how we were going to play with them just get them in and stick them out there. Hogan obviously being the perfect example. 2nd season. Less money spent on fees but absolute fortunes on big wages for experienced players. We had enough quality in the team to finish 4th but could never be consistent enough to properly challenge for the top 2. The spine of the team dissappears as key players are on loan or short term contracts. Obviously this summer was a shambles for many reasons but we end up with 65 wingers and 2 centre halves. This isn't 100% the fault of the managers we've had. A modern club would have a proper scouting set up to recommend players to the manager. We just seem to sign either who is doing well or who is available.

My hope is that since the moment Smith came in he and the recruitment people have been planning for the summer. I'd be disappointed if we hadn't already lined up a few deals for players who'll be out of contract come June. Clubs don't sign players until then because in a lot of cases the players aren't actually available until the last day. The selling club may not want to sell until they're own bids come off. But usually the bids have gone in a lot earlier. Bruce's bid for McKenna was an exception.
